On April 16, 1963, Martin Luther King Jr. wrote a long and passionate letter addressed to his dear fellow clergymen. After years of engaging the struggle for civil rights with a commitment to nonviolent resistance – after months of separation from his family, after weeks of sleepless nights, after long court battles, and numerous stays in jail, after a lifetime of oppression and a life in segregation, his struggle was condemned in bold print in a local paper. This was one among many rejections, but this one he felt he must answer, as it raised in him such righteous indignation that he couldn’t be silent.

Our individual perspectives do not prevent a common understanding.

I might define a Granny Smith apple by telling you about its round and shiny light green exterior.  My friend who has a great appreciation for the fruit's taste might explain its tart sweetness and near floral scent.  An owner of a Granny Smith orchard might define a Granny Smith by sharing its growing season, predators, and preferred climate.  And if any of us was asked to define what exactly an "apple" is - the task would explode with complexity.  Yet in most instances, when the word "apple" is shared in conversation, understanding abounds.
